Why is a photographic portrait necessary?



Preservation of memory and family legacy: Portraits allow people to preserve their history and identity over time, serving as a visual testament for future generations.

Professional representation: In the workplace, a professional portrait on profiles and resumes helps establish a trustworthy and approachable presence, facilitating connections and opportunities.

Artistic and personal expression: Portraits offer a way for individuals to express themselves and see themselves reflected in a work of art, strengthening their self-esteem and sense of identity.

Historical and cultural documentation: Throughout history, portraits have captured significant moments and contributed to building a society's collective memory.

In short, portrait photography is essential for documenting, celebrating, and reflecting on individual and collective identity, playing a crucial role in preserving our history and culture.
